Bella and Missy: Thank you so much for your compliments on my brows! I tweeze them myself. As a matter of fact, I've been growing them in since I joined the site when I realized that natural brows are "in". Where have I been??
I just use the standard method of leaving my brow to grow to being equal with the middle of my nostril, and then extend past my eye until it reaches an angle that goes about 45degrees from your nostril, and then past the edge of the eye. I also trim them. Usually I fill them in too, so it was really hard to post them looking au natural
